body
{
    scrollbar-face-color:#fff;
    scrollbar-highlight-color:#414141;
    scrollbar-shadow-color:#D2D2D2;
    scrollbar-3dlight-color:#fff;
    scrollbar-arrow-color:#07638E;
    scrollbar-track-color:#fff;
    scrollbar-darkshadow-color:#fff;
}

body,td,p
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    line-height:        120%;
    font-size:          9pt;
    color:              #414141;
}

p
{
    text-align:         justify;
}

a:link,a:active,a:visited
{
    color:              #414141;
}

a:hover
{
    text-decoration:    underline;
    color:              #07638E;
}

hr
{
    height:             1px;
    border:             solid silver 0;
    border-top-width:   1px;
}

IMG
{
    border:             0;
}

ul.menulevel1,ul.menulevel2,ul.menulevel3,ul.sitemaplevel1,ul.sitemaplevel2,ul.sitemaplevel3,ul.submenu,ul.search
{
    padding-left:       0;
    margin-left:        0;
    list-style:         none;
}

li
{
    line-height:        1.5;
}

li.doc
{
    padding-left:       12px;
    background-image:   url(menu/doc.gif);
    background-repeat:  no-repeat;
}

li.docs
{
    padding-left:       12px;
    background-image:   url(menu/docs.gif);
    background-repeat:  no-repeat;
}

li.sdoc
{
    padding-left:       12px;
    background-image:   url(menu/sdoc.gif);
    background-repeat:  no-repeat;
}

li.sdocs
{
    padding-left:       12px;
    background-image:   url(menu/sdocs.gif);
    background-repeat:  no-repeat;
}

#hvmenu
{
    height:             20px;
    width:              695px;
    border-top:         0 solid #414141;
    border-right:       0 solid #414141;
    border-bottom:      0 solid #414141;
    border-left:        0 solid #414141;
}

.sitename
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-weight:        400;
    color:              #414141;
    font-size:          9pt;
    letter-spacing:     0;
}

.menulevel1 a:link,.menulevel1 a:visited,.menulevel1 a:active,.menulevel1 a:hover,.menulevel2 a:link,.menulevel2 a:visited,.menulevel2 a:active,.menulevel2 a:hover,.menulevel3 a:link,.menulevel3 a:visited,.menulevel3 a:active,.menulevel3 a:hover,.locator a:link,.locator a:visited,.locator a:active,.locator a:hover,.navigator a:link,.sitemaplevel1 a:link,.sitemaplevel2 a:link,.sitemaplevel3 a:link,.sitemaplevel1 a:visited,.sitemaplevel2 a:visited,.sitemaplevel3 a:visited,.sitemaplevel1 a:active,.sitemaplevel2 a:active,.sitemaplevel3 a:active,.sitemaplevel1 a:hover,.sitemaplevel2 a:hover,.sitemaplevel3 a:hover,.submenu a:link,.submenu a:visited,.submenu a:active,.submenu a:hover
{
    text-decoration:    none;
}

.menu a
{
    text-decoration:    underline;
    font-weight:        400;
}

.login,.login a,.login a:link,.login a:visited,.login a:active,.login a:hover
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-weight:        700;
    color:              #07638E;
    font-size:          9pt;
    letter-spacing:     0;
    text-decoration:    none;
}

.edit
{
    font-size:          9pt;
    color:              #000;
    background-color:   #E1E1E1;
}

.edit a:link,.edit a:visited,.edit a:active,.edit a:hover
{
    font-weight:        400;
    text-decoration:    none;
    color:              #414141;
}

input,select
{
    font-size:          9pt;
    text-indent:        2px;
}

textarea
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-size:          9pt;
    color:              #414141;
    background-color:   transparent;
    width:              98%;
}

.searchbox .submit
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-size:          9pt;
    color:              #fff;
    font-weight:        400;
    border:             1px solid #0A80B8;
    background-color:   #0A80B8;
}

.searchbox .text
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-size:          9pt;
    color:              #414141;
    background-color:   transparent;
    border:             1px solid #414141;
}

.bodyline
{
    background-color:   #414141;
    border:             1px #414141 solid;
}

.cmsline
{
    background-color:   #414141;
    border:             2px #414141 solid;
}

.innerline
{
    border:             2px #414141 solid;
}

.copyright
{
    font-size:          9pt;
    color:              #414141;
}

.copyright a:hover,.copyright a:active
{
    color:              #0A80B8;
    text-decoration:    none;
}

#navlist li
{
    font-size:          9pt;
    color:              #07638E;
    font-weight:        400;
    float:              left;
    padding-right:      20px;
    padding-left:       15px;
    display:            inline;
    list-style-type:    none;
    text-decoration:    none;
    margin:             0;
}

#navlist a:hover
{
    font-size:          9pt;
    color:              #07638E;
    font-weight:        400;
    float:              left;
    margin:             0;
}

.wbt a:link,.wbt a:active,.wbt a:visited
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-size:          9pt;
    display:            block;
    text-align:         left;
    margin-top:         2px;
    font-weight:        400;
    color:              #07638E;
    background-image:   url(images/wbt.png);
    background-repeat:  no-repeat;
    padding:            3px 2px 2px 9px;
}

.wbt a:hover
{
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-size:          9pt;
    display:            block;
    text-align:         left;
    margin-top:         2px;
    font-weight:        400;
    color:              #000;
    background-image:   url(images/wbt_hoover.png);
    padding:            3px 2px 2px 7px;
}

#navcontainer
{
    margin-top:         5px;
}

#navcontainer ul
{
    list-style-type:    none;
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    font-weight:        400;
    font-size:          12pt;
    color:              #07638E;
    margin:             0;
    padding:            0;
}

#navcontainer a
{
    display:            block;
    font-family:        Verdana, "DejaVu Sans", "Bitstream Vera Sans", Geneva, sans-serif; 
    text-decoration:    none;
    font-size:          12pt;
    background-repeat:  no-repeat;
    background-position:0 0;
    font-weight:        400;
    color:              #fff;
    padding:            4px 5px;
}

#navcontainer a:hover
{
    text-decoration:    none;
    background-repeat:  no-repeat;
    background-image:   url(emptyarrow.gif);
    background-color:   #F29200;
    color:              #07638E;
}

#navcontainer ul ul a
{
    display:            block;
    text-decoration:    none;
    font-weight:        400;
    color:              #07638E;
    padding:            2px 2px 2px 10px;
}

#navcontainer ul ul a:hover
{
    text-decoration:    none;
    color:              #fff;
}

.activeclass1
{
    background-color:   #F29200;
    border-top-width:   1px;
    border-top-style:   solid;
    border-top-color:   #fff;
    background-image:   url(arrow.gif);
    background-repeat:  no-repeat;
    font-color:         #fff;
}

.inactiveclass1
{
    background-color:   #07638E;
    border-top-width:   1px;
    border-top-style:   solid;
    border-top-color:   #fff;
}

H1, H2, H3, H4
{
    font-weight:        700;
    margin-bottom:      6px;
    color:              #07638E;
}

H1
{
    font-size:          16pt;
    letter-spacing:     2px;
}

H2
{
    font-size:          14pt;
}

H3
{
    font-size:          12pt;
}

H4
{
    margin:             0;
    font-size:          10pt;
}

form,#navcontainer li,#navcontainer ul ul li
{
    margin:             0;
}

.menulevel1,.menulevel2,.menulevel3,.locator,.navigator,.sitemaplevel1,.sitemaplevel2,.sitemaplevel3,.submenu,.menu
{
    font-weight:        400;
    font-size:          9pt;
    color:              #414141;
}

.navigator a,.printer a,.search a,.date
{
    font-weight:        400;
    color:              #414141;
}

.navigator a:link,.navigator a:visited,.printer a:link,.printer a:visited,.printer a:active,.printer a:hover,.search a:link,.search a:visited,.copyright a,.copyright a:link,.copyright a:visited
{
    color:              #414141;
    text-decoration:    none;
}

.navigator a:active,.navigator a:hover,.search a:active,.search a:hover
{
    color:              #07638E;
    text-decoration:    none;
}

#navlist ul,#navlist a:link,#navlist a:visited,#navlist a:active
{
    font-size:          9pt;
    color:              #414141;
    font-weight:        400;
    float:              left;
    margin:             0;
}

.inactiveclass2,.inactiveclass3
{
    background-color:   #D9F1FD;
    border-top-width:   1px;
    border-top-style:   solid;
    border-top-color:   #fff;
}

.activeclass2,.activeclass3
{
    background-color:   #F29200;
    border-top-width:   1px;
    border-top-style:   solid;
    border-top-color:   #fff;
    background-image:   url(arrow.gif);
    background-repeat:  no-repeat;
}
t

